微创经皮钢板接骨术治疗胫骨骨折

摘    要:目的 评价经皮微创钢板接骨术治疗胫骨骨折的临床疗效。方法 运用此技术治疗胫骨骨折54例。于胫骨内侧建立皮下隧道,经此隧道将钢板穿置在胫骨内侧骨膜上,骨折间接复位,低密度螺钉予以固定。结果 全部病例获随访,时间12~26个月,平均18个月,骨折愈合时间10~16周,平均12周,无骨折延迟愈合及不愈合,无感染及内固定失败等并发症。结论 微创经皮钢板接骨术符合生物学固定原则,有利于骨折的愈合。

Treatment of Tibial Fracture Using Minimally Invasive Percutaneous Plate Osteosynthesis

Abstract:Objective To evaluate the effect of mininally invasive percutaneous plate osteosynthesis (MIPPO) for treatment of tibial fractures. Methods Mininally invasive percutaneous plate osteosynthesis was used to treat 54 cases of tibial fractures, A subcutaneous tunnel was created along the medial border of the tibial. Axial alignment of the fracture was performed using indirect reduction techniques. A LC- DCP was inserted into the subcutaneous tunnel. The plateusing fewer screws was placed onto the extraperiosteal surface an optimal fixation. Results All the patients were followed up for 12 - 26 months after operation (average18 months). All the fractures were healed with an average healing time of 12weeks without delay union and nonunion, no inflammation and internal fixation failure hap-pended. Conclusion Minimally invasive percutaneous plate osteosynthesis is according with biological osteosynthesis, and with the advantage of accelerating bone healing.
